Output 6f622478894de6a04c21258843968856e667a76ae86e4b1026bcbf95496a2d65:4

value
28864822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8711cb7bb2de91f6035b0dfeadfc225e08e6d785 OP_EQUAL
address
3E1CTrCnbiBd9c8HxwFvKWUg6imVSSEHXH
transaction
6f622478894de6a04c21258843968856e667a76ae86e4b1026bcbf95496a2d65
confirmations
393881
spent
true